I'm a new mother to a 37day old boy. He's fed solely on my BM. Need advice on how to go about feeding him while im out and about. Do i have to go hunt for a nursing room each time i hv to nurse him? Or just feed him right there when he's hungry; ie bench in the park/road side/toilet cubical?

I still don't like the idea of draping a piece of cloth over him if nursing him out in the open. I will feel weird. Will my bb suffocate under the cloth?

Can any of you mummies share your BF experiences?
 


Hi Yvonne, for my #1, I went to the nursing room to latch him. So, impt to find places with clean and nice nursing rooms. There are many new malls with very clean nursing rooms.

But then when my baby din want to latch anymore, I pumped out and still feed him the EBM in a nursing room cos I dun like the idea of feeding him in public even tho he was feeding fr bottle.
 
When baby is young and latching, it will be probably easier to plan trips to places where it's more conducive for you to feed and change baby. Eg mommy friendly malls, like united square, forum, etc,

I would usually use my sling as a shield. The material is very light and porous. It would not be suffocating at all. Well, I tried it on myself and to convince my husband before baby was born.
 
Toilet cubicles may or may not be clean. You wouldn't want to be feeding halfway and then realize from your sense of scent that the person next door is having pungent diarrhea.

But yes, i have brought baby into the toilet before, I think that was orchard hotel.

Don't stress, play by ear. It will all work out well. Enjoy your outing!!! :)))
 
Nursing cover is good, can feed whenever and anywhere u want but need to be in the air con places.
It is very hot inside, I sometimes used a hand fan while feeding in e cover.
 
Yes, nursing covers are rather thick. Good that you have a handheld fan.

Slings or light pashminas can be used in place of nursing covers and they will serve more purposes than one.
